-{ Quote: "Gates primes the pump for Longhorn
By John Leyden
Published Tuesday 27th January 2004 17:07 GMT
Microsoft will probably ship the client version of Longhorn before its server counterpart, says Bill Gates.
This tentative prediction was made in Gates's rallying call to software developers to get behind the next version of Windows, at the Developing Software for the future Microsoft Platform in London yesterday. Even though Longhorm isn't due until 2006, Microsoft used the conference to build developer enthusiasm ("prime the pump") for the next version of Windows, which promises substantial architectural changes.
Longhorn's major features include a revamp of the presentation layer (codenamed Avalon), a radical restructuring of the file system (WinFS) and far deeper integration of Web services technology (Indigo).
